    Yes bob they do have great service. While people are on this thread i thought i will ask everyones opinions. Should i get a apprenticeship? I am working with a jeweller and he is teaching me as he would an apprentice( he can't put me on as an apprentice as he is sick and not to well. But i just wont get a certificate. He is saying that learning at my own pace and learning what i need to each day is better then getting an apprenticeship. What do you think. Do people value a certificate? Do they care? As long as you do good work is this all that matters? (I've never heard anyone walking into a jewellery shop and ask to see your qualification but im sure theres someone who has )And does anyone know is i can still get a certificate after a certain number of hours working at the bench ? By the way he was self taught and he even taught michael hitcock who now has many stores around queensland and probably in other states too. Any thoughts are appreciated as im stuck on what to do.

    If you are going to run you own business or work as a hobbyist a apprenticeship would not be that important, if you wish to work for a employer then the apprenticeship is more relevant
    as it tells the employer that you have or should have the required skills he is looking for.
